Migraines affecting about 6% of the population tend to ocurr in women more often than men and may become less severe with age.

Many experts believe that blood vessels on the surface of the brain expand, causing the area around them to become inflamed and irritate nerve endings resulting in a migraine. The pain you experience during a migraine may be caused by the resulting dilation and irritation. The inflammation and irritation may also lead to nausea, light and sound sensitivity, and other symptoms associated with migraine.

Through the use of computer imaging technologies, doctors have been able to observe the brain during migraine attacks. These observations have lead doctors to believe that there is a migraine pain center located in the brainstem near the base of the brain. Surrounding blood vessels enlarge and become inflamed resulting in the pain of a migraine. Prompt treatment is required for relief.

Sumatriptan - Generic Imigran® / Imitrex®

Shelf Name: Suminat 50

Sumatriptan (Generic Imigran® / Generic Imitrex®), taken at the beginning of a migraine headache, may reduce the severity of the headache. It is not effective in preventing migraines. It can also stop the upset stomach, vomiting, and sensitivity to light and noise associated with migraine headaches. This medication is not to be used for other types of headaches.
